Ingredients for Easy Oreo Milkshake

  • 4 Oreo cookies
  • 2 cups vanilla ice cream
  • 1 cup milk (whole or low-fat, your choice)

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. Crush the Oreos: Start by placing the Oreo cookies in a resealable plastic bag. Using a rolling pin or your hands, crush them into small pieces—make sure to leave a few larger chunks for that satisfying crunch later!
  2. Blend Ingredients: In a blender, add the crushed Oreos, vanilla ice cream, and milk. Blend on high speed until smooth and creamy. Adjust the consistency by adding more milk if you prefer a thinner shake.
  3. Final Mix: Once blended, give your milkshake a quick stir with a spoon to ensure any larger cookie pieces are mixed in.
  4. Serve: Pour the milkshake into tall glasses and top with whipped cream and extra crushed Oreos if desired. Grab a straw and sip away!

Top Tips for Perfecting Easy Oreo Milkshake

  • Keep it Halal: Use Halal-certified ingredients to ensure it meets your dietary requirements. Most vanilla ice creams are Halal, but it’s always best to check the label.
  • Consistency Matters: If you want a thicker milkshake, reduce the amount of milk. For a thinner consistency, add a little more milk as you blend.
  • Substitution Tips: If you’re looking for a twist, try substituting vanilla ice cream with cookies and cream or chocolate ice cream. It’s a fun way to shake things up!
  • Chill Your Glasses: For an extra frosty treat, chill your serving glasses in the freezer for about 10 minutes before pouring in the milkshake.

Storing and Reheating Tips

While it’s best to enjoy your Easy Oreo Milkshake fresh, you can store any leftovers in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ours. Make sure to transfer it to an airtight container to maintain its creaminess. Unfortunately, reheating isn’t ideal, as it might alter the texture. If you really must, give it a quick blend again to help restore some of that original goodness!

Frequently Asked Questions

  1. Can I make a dairy-free version of this milkshake?
    Absolutely! Substitute the vanilla ice cream with a dairy-free ice cream alternative and use a plant-based milk substitute.
  2. What if I want a less sweet version?
    You can reduce the number of Oreo cookies you use or opt for a less sweet ice cream.
  3. Can I add other flavors?
    Yes! Feel free to mix in some chocolate syrup, peanut butter, or even mint for a unique twist on this classic milkshake.
